This example shows how to install cert-manager
and how to create a Self Signed
Root Certificate Authority. Also, this example generates a certificate from Root
CA and installs it on Nginx, using a client to make HTTP requests to this web
server via cURL.
Traefik is configured to talk with backend via HTTPS using a servers transport.
k3d cluster create \
--config ../k3d-example.yaml
kubectl apply \
--filename https://github.com/cert-manager/cert-manager/releases/download/v1.8.2/cert-manager.yaml
kubectl apply \
--kustomize .
